If Williams can pass a physical I'd like to see him in red and gold more than I would either Samuel or Brown, tbh. Samuel is basically a slot guy, and what we really need is a guy that can play outside.

Brown can play outside, but there are weaknesses/holes in his game. Williams is at least a complete WR, when healthy.

However, the best overall WR left is still OBJ. The only weakness in his game is that he doesn't have deep speed anymore. But in every other aspect as a WR, he's the best available. If he could be had for say two years/$25 million with incentives up to maybe $30 million? That would fix nearly all of the WR issues in one guy.


Although, on a personal level, I just don't like his personality. But his teammates have always been pretty positive abut him, so maybe I'm just wrong about him.
